Glenn I. MacInnes

2013

In 2013, Glenn I. MacInnes earned a total compensation of $1.2M as Executive Vice President, Chief Financial Officer at Webster Financial, a 1% decrease compared to previous year.

Compensation breakdown

Non-Equity Incentive Plan$225,000
Option Awards$297,838
Salary$400,000
Stock Awards$244,992
Other$54,325
Total$1,222,155

MacInnes received $400K in salary, accounting for 33% of the total pay in 2013.

MacInnes also received $225K in non-equity incentive plan, $297.8K in option awards, $245K in stock awards and $54.3K in other compensation.
